MorphoStyle framework enables shape-aware motion style transfer

Researchers have developed MorphoStyle, a new framework for transferring motion styles onto human animations while maintaining control over body shape. This method utilizes a shape-conditioned Finite-Scalar-Quantization Variational Auto-Encoder (FSQ-VAE) to disentangle style and shape information. MorphoStyle employs a contrastive style encoder, a text-guided style-routing mechanism, and a manifold-preserving style modulator to achieve its goals. Experiments show that MorphoStyle surpasses existing methods in both shape control and motion style transfer. AI
